Buy and sell liquidity can be divided into two types - internal liquidity and external liquidity.

By withdrawal of external liquidity we can determine the trend.

If external liquidity is updated from the highs and the lows remain - the trend is upward. If external liquidity is updated from the lows and the highs remain - the trend is downward.

How to define external liquidity?

External liquidity is formed behind the structural elements during a trend movement.

In a trending movement, external liquidity will be updated when new HH / LL structural elements are formed and when confirmed HL / LH elements are broken.

How to define internal liquidity?

Internal liquidity is formed between structural elements during a trend movement (HL and HH in an ascending structure, LH and LL in a descending structure).

In a trending movement, the update of internal liquidity will occur during a complex correction, on the formation of HL and LH.

Liquidity during an uptrend

In an uptrend, after an update of external liquidity to buy, an update of internal liquidity to sell is expected.

The best opportunities to open long positions will appear when testing bullish zones of interest below 0.5 of the trading range (in the Discount zone), in front of which pools of internal liquidity to sell are formed.

Targets for position fixation can be an update of a significant pool of internal liquidity to buy and an update of external liquidity behind the previous HH.

Smart Capital artificially forms pools of internal liquidity to sell in front of the bullish zone of interest to fill its orders. Internal and external liquidity to buy will be formed by smart capital in order to make a future markup of the asset by activating stop losses.

After updating the internal liquidity to sell and testing the zone of interest, the price will tend to update the external liquidity to buy, forming a new higher high (HH).

To more accurately determine the internal liquidity, you can use the lower timeframes.


Liquidity during a downtrend

In a downtrend, after an update of external liquidity to sell, an update of internal liquidity to buy is expected.

Pay attention to bearish zones of interest above 0.5 of the trading range, in front of which pools of internal liquidity to buy are formed. On activation of these stop losses there will be opportunities to open short positions.

Targets for position fixation can be updating of the significant pool of internal liquidity for selling and updating of external liquidity behind the previous LL.

Internal liquidity for buying will be used by smart capital to fill their orders. External and internal liquidity to sell will be used for future markdowns and position allocation.

After updating the internal liquidity to buy and testing the zone of interest, the price will tend to update the external liquidity to sell, forming a new lower low (LL).

External and internal liquidity should always be considered in conjunction with the context of the higher timeframes - the overall price direction and zones of interest.
